Creating with Intention: How to Maximize Every Corner



One of one of the most effective approaches for making a little room feel larger is to offer every thing a certain purpose-- and ideally, greater than one. As an example, a storage ottoman can work as a coffee table, added seating, and a location to tuck away coverings or games. A bench by the entrance might function as footwear storage space and a place to sit while putting them on.



Shade and light also play a major function in multifunctional areas. Lighter tones can assist a room really feel more open, while calculated lighting highlights useful locations and produces aesthetic balance. Mirrors can show light and make a room really feel two times its size, specifically when placed near windows or lamps.



Multifunctionality isn't nearly individual pieces-- it's additionally regarding flow. The layout of an area ought to make it simple to change from one task to another without major disruption. That may imply selecting lightweight furniture that's very easy to relocate, or using drapes and folding displays to different areas momentarily.



Smart Furniture Choices for Small Living



Furnishings can either make or damage a multifunctional space. Selecting the best pieces is essential, especially when your goal is to mix comfort and function without frustrating the area. Investing in a few high-quality things that are adaptable will certainly repay in everyday convenience.



Search for things that supply hidden compartments, like couches with under-seat storage space or beds that raise to disclose area below. A drop-leaf dining table can be expanded for visitors or folded down when not in use, making it optimal for smaller homes. If you delight in organizing, consider a sleeper sofa or a daybed that easily shifts into a resting area without compromising your design.
